Find the ratio in the lowest term
a) 1.5 meter and 75 cm
b) 600 meter and 1.2 km

Answer:

2; 0.5

Step-by-step explanation:

1.5 m and 75 cm

1.5m= 150 cm

150 cm>75 cm

[tex] \frac{150}{75} = 2[/tex]

600 m and 1.2 km

1.2 km=1200 m

600 m<1200 m

[tex] \frac{600}{1200} = 0.5[/tex]
